History of Brushless Motors

The history of motors began with the discovery of electromagnetic phenomena in the early 19th century.
So far, numerous types of motors have been developed including direct current (DC) motors, induction motors, and synchronous motors.

Brushless motors have a long history as permanent magnetic synchronic motors (PMSM), but they have not been used except for industrial applications with expensive control mechanisms due to the difficulties in starting and changing speed.
In recent years, brushless motors have been rapidly developed for a wide range of fields, due to the development of strong permanent magnets, the ease of inverter control by semiconductor elements, and the increased awareness of energy conservation.
